“I worked in Retail for a long time, and I wanted a change that would give me many opportunities to grow. After a lot of consideration and speaking to family we thought it would be a good idea to apply for an apprenticeship as I would be getting a qualification and experience in a different work environment. I’ve worked at Midland Heart for over a year now and I believe that I have learnt so many things; I have become more confident speaking to customers, provided training to other colleagues and had the opportunity to shadow different departments. One of the benefits of the apprenticeship is the level of exposure to the business which helps you understand your long term career goals, in a supportive environment. It’s not without challenges – balancing studies and work, however I have had amazing support and guidance from my manager and team members. I’d definitely recommend it!”
